WebArtworks that depict baby Jesus held by his mother, Mary, characteristically as the primary focus of the artwork. The image of Madonna and child is one of the most common in Christian art; iconic depictions have been created by Duccio, Leonardo da Vinci, and Caravaggio, among countless others. WebIn this painting by Fra Filippo Lippi, Madonna and Child with Two Angels —a variation on the Madonna and Child Enthroned (see Giotto or Cimabue) that artists have been painting for hundreds of years—halos virtually disappear. Fra Filippo Lippi, Madonna and Child with Two Angels , tempera on wood, c. 1455 - 1466 (Galleria degli Uffizi, Florence)
